Protect your furniture from renovation hazards

Renovation work, especially large-scale projects, generates lots of dust, noise, and movement in your home. Storing your furniture in a secure unit helps you:

  • Preserve its condition: keep it safe from scratches, paint stains, and accidental knocks.
  • Avoid premature wear caused by prolonged exposure to adverse conditions (humidity, dust).
  • Maintain its value: whether antique pieces or modern furniture, a dedicated space ensures proper protection.

Create room to work smoothly

Major projects like installing a new kitchen, floor renovations, or replacing windows require a clear workspace. With a MondialBox® unit, you can:

  • Clear the rooms being renovated to allow better circulation for workers and tools.
  • Avoid cluttering shared areas with displaced furniture.
  • Speed up the work by removing obstacles.

Tips for storing furniture properly

  • Protect furniture with suitable covers or blankets to prevent scuffs.
  • Disassemble bulky pieces like beds or tables to save space.
  • Place heavy items at the back of the unit and stack lighter ones on top to maximize space.
